Wood shake roof repair services involve inspecting and restoring roofs made from wooden shingles or shakes to ensure they remain durable and effective. These services typically address issues such as cracked, split, or rotting shakes, as well as areas affected by weather damage, pests, or age-related wear. Repair work may include replacing damaged shakes, sealing leaks, reinforcing weakened sections, and treating the wood to prevent future deterioration. Proper repair helps extend the lifespan of the roof and maintains its protective qualities, keeping a property secure and well-maintained.
Many common problems that lead homeowners to seek wood shake roof repair include water leaks, visible damage from storms or high winds, and the presence of mold or rot. Over time, exposure to moisture and the elements can cause shakes to warp or decay, compromising the roof’s integrity. Additionally, pests such as termites or wood-boring insects may cause damage that requires professional attention.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line, preserving the roof’s appearance and functionality.

The overview below groups typical Wood Shake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sanford,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wood shake roof repairs in the Sanford area range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ged shakes, fall within this range. Larger or more complex repairs can sometimes exceed $1,000.
Partial Replacements - Replacing sections of a wood shake roof us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. This range covers common projects like replacing multiple damaged shakes or sections, with fewer jobs reaching higher amounts for extensive work.
Full Roof Replacement - A complete wood shake roof replacement in the Sanford region typically falls between $8,000 and $15,000. Larger, more intricate projects can go beyond $20,000, though most residential replacements tend to stay within the middle to upper part of this range.
Maintenance and Upgrades - Routine maintenance or upgrades, such as sealing or minor repairs, generally cost $300-$1,200. These projects are often smaller in scope, but costs can increase for extensive upgrades or preventative treatments that involve more materials and labor.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a wood shake roof needs repair? Signs include cracked, curled, or missing shakes, water stains on ceilings, and visible rot or mold on the roof surface.
Can local contractors handle different types of wood shake roof damage? Yes, experienced service providers can address various issues such as storm damage, rot, insect infestation, and general wear and tear.
What should I consider before hiring a contractor for wood shake roof repair? It's important to review their experience with wood shake roofs, request references, and ensure they use quality materials suitable for your roof.
Are there specific maintenance tips to prolong the life of a wood shake roof? Regular inspections, clearing debris, trimming overhanging branches, and addressing minor damages promptly can help extend the roof’s lifespan.
